Output 137317ee790d2435aa12772d1356fef3e668d724a0ddf74a1e62d5356165c0dd:7

value
384295237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dc5671739d73e0bf41456e52105e06e0074d59b OP_EQUAL
address
35s2oxQPJBTGZCAqEQkX4utDCpV4SZM3nK
transaction
137317ee790d2435aa12772d1356fef3e668d724a0ddf74a1e62d5356165c0dd
spent
true